    Abstract

    Smart Door device is a two-part single compact fully automated HD digital surveillance unit, comprising smart phone technology and tablet technology and complex computer sound, light and motion sensors. Speech technology Photographic technology, toxin and metal detector, GPS, alarms and LED scrolling display and intercom, all internal parts, a two part unit that's connected to each other through a hole in the upper center of the door, an intelligent identifying system that providing information and accurately answers questions by phone or at door.

    Claims

    1. A door comprising: a device for monitoring activity around the door; alarms; a system which has information about the owner of a home, apartment or dwelling; said door comprising an area on outside of door and an area inside of said door.

    2. The door of claim 1 further comprising a peephole.

    3. The door of claim 2 further comprising a camera lens placed in said peephole.

    4. The door of claim 1 further comprising a microphone.

    5. The door of claim 1 wherein said device for monitoring activity around said door comprises sensors.

    6. The door of claim 1 further comprising a flat touch screen monitor and control panel attached to inside of said door.

    7. The door of claim 1 further comprising an I-phone.

    8. The door of claim 1 further comprising I pad technology.

    9. The door of claim 3 wherein said door comprises a knob or other device for rotating said camera lens in the peephole.

    10. The door of claim 6 wherein said control panel includes a monitor or program that so a user inside said dwelling sees on any TV in said dwelling who is at said door.

    11. The door of claim 1 further comprising a doorbell which plays ring tones.

    12. The door of claim 1 further comprising a camera or video device which takes pictures and videos of persons who present themselves in front of said door.

    13. The door of claim 1 further comprising a recording device which is integrated or attached to said door so that a user can leave an automated recording informing a person at said door that no one is home and at what moment a person will be returning home.

    14. The door of claim 1 further comprising a recording device which is integrated or attached to said door so that a person on outside of said door leaves a message to people who live in said dwelling.

    15. The door of claim 1 further comprising an intercom button which calls a person's cell phone who lives in said dwelling.

    16. The door of claim 6 wherein said control panel texts a picture, or videos, and automatically emails owner of said dwelling when the door is opened by persons outside or inside said dwelling.

    17. The door of claim 1 further comprising a smoke detector, or carbon monoxide detector.

    18. The door of claim 1 further comprising a sensor alarm around said door, which notifies police or security and provides name and address of dwelling.

    19. The door of claim 1 further comprising a sound sensor.

    20. The door of claim 1 wherein said door is connected to other security devices within a building.

    DETAILED DESCRIPTION

    [0044] FIG. 1 shows the outside of a door 10, having a doorbell and intercom 12 and a peephole 14 having a camera 16 within it.

    [0045] FIG. 2 shows the inside of a door 20, having a monitor 22 and controls for the monitor 24.

    [0046] FIG. 3 shows the side view of a monitor 26 which is used with a door of the present invention.

    [0047] FIG. 4 shows a camera 28 used in a door of the present invention. The camera can be fitted into a peephole of the door or placed in another area of the door.

    [0048] FIG. 5 shows the program controls 30 used in connection with a door of the present invention.

    [0049] FIG. 6 shows an intercom and bell 32 which is used in connection with the door of the present invention.

    [0050] FIG. 7 shows a monitor 34 used in connection with the door of the present invention.

    [0051] FIG. 8 shows a door 50 having a pivoting member 52. When the pivoting member is open, a camera lens 54 is inside the pivoting member. The door 50 also contains doorbell sensors 56 an a microphone intercom 58. The door 50 further contains a smoke and carbon monoxide detector 60. The door further contains a battery 62.

    [0052] FIG. 9 shows an alarm 70 used in connection with the door of the present invention.

    [0053] FIG. 10 shows a door 100 showing a monitor 102 which slides into an existing door peephole 104.
